I agree with Sunsally on most of the aspects discussed here. I would like to add that the 10% numbers are rule of thumb and may be different based on your situation. As an example, I'm located in a small college town next to campus. I have a local population of approximately 20,000 and a college crowd of about 8000. Because the locals don't like to frequent where the college kids hang out, my local business is at most 3%. My college business is closer to 25%.
